Great spot for pizza and drinks, especially if you’re in New Buffalo on a nice day. The outdoor seating is a huge plus — perfect place to relax after a beach day or while wandering around town. The pizza is solid, with good crust and plenty of topping options, and the service has always been friendly and quick for us. It can get busy during peak times, but that’s New Buffalo for you. A reliable stop for a casual dinner and a laid-back evening.

I grew up on Chicago-style pizza — the real kind: thin crust. It feels like thick crust or ‘NY style’ is all you can find around NB and MC, Fl or anywhere including chain owned pizza reiks.
So this thin-crust pizza they baked for us was a very welcome discovery after searching all for a year! It was so delicious we will order again and again! Thank you!
